| INFO FOR PEOPLE ADDING CHANGES: |
| |
| Check the DTD (apichanges.dtd) for details on the syntax. You do not |
| need to regenerate the HTML, as this is part of Javadoc generation; just |
| change the XML. Rough syntax of a change (several parts optional): |
| |
| <change> |
| <api name="compiler"/> |
| <summary>Some brief description here, can use <b>XHTML</b></summary> |
| <version major="1" minor="99"/> |
| <date day="13" month="6" year="2001"/> |
| <author login="jrhacker"/> |
| <compatibility addition="yes"/> |
| <description> |
| The main description of the change here. |
| Again can use full <b>XHTML</b> as needed. |
| </description> |
| <class package="org.openide.compiler" name="DoWhatIWantCompiler"/> |
| <issue number="14309"/> |
| </change> |
| |
| Also permitted elements: <package>, <branch>. <version> is API spec |
| version, recommended for all new changes. <compatibility> should say |
| if things were added/modified/deprecated/etc. and give all information |
| related to upgrading old code. List affected top-level classes and |
| link to issue numbers if applicable. See the DTD for more details. |
| |
| Changes need not be in any particular order, they are sorted in various |
| ways by the stylesheet anyway. |
| |
| Dates are assumed to mean "on the trunk". If you *also* make the same |
| change on a stabilization branch, use the <branch> tag to indicate this |
| and explain why the change was made on a branch in the <description>. |
| |
| Please only change this file on the trunk! Rather: you can change it |
| on branches if you want, but these changes will be ignored; only the |
| trunk version of this file is important. |
| |
| Deprecations do not count as incompatible, assuming that code using the |
| deprecated calls continues to see their documented behavior. But do |
| specify deprecation="yes" in <compatibility>. |
| |
| This file is not a replacement for Javadoc: it is intended to list changes, |
| not describe the complete current behavior, for which ordinary documentation |
| is the proper place. |

| <change id="help_ctx" > |
| <api name="palette_api"/> |
| <summary>Added helpId attribute</summary> |
| <version major="1" minor="7"/> |
| <date day="16" month="10" year="2006"/> |
| <author login="saubrecht"/> |
| <compatibility addition="yes"/> |
| <description> |
| <p> |
| Now it's possible to add <em>helpId</em> attribute to palette's root, categories and items |
| that will be used to create appropriate HelpCtx. The attribute can be specified |
| in XML layer as a folder (palette's root and categories) or file attribute |
| (palette items) or it can be provided directly by appropriate Nodes. |
| </p> |
| <p> |
| When F1 key is pressed in palette's window then first the selected item is asked |
| for HelpCtx id. If no item is selected or it does not provide specific help id then |
| selected category is checked for help id. If the category does not provide any help id |
| either then palette's root is asked for help id. If the root does not define any then |
| the default help id <em>CommonPalette</em> will be used. |
| </p> |
| </description> |
| <issue number="77387"/> |
| </change> |

| <change id="mime-type-associations" > |
| <api name="palette_api"/> |
| <summary>Allow associating palette content with document mime type.</summary> |
| <version major="1" minor="10"/> |
| <date day="27" month="2" year="2007"/> |
| <author login="saubrecht"/> |
| <compatibility addition="yes"/> |
| <description> |
| <p> |
| The previous version of palette API mandated that editor TopComponent had to insert a |
| PaletteController instance into its Lookup if it wants to associate the palette with it. |
| Now it is possible to associate the palette also with an existing |
| editor without the need to change its implementation, e.g. to add code snippets |
| palette to java source editor. |
| </p> |
| <p> |
| If the mime type of active editor window has an associated instance of PaletteController |
| in the XML layer system then palette window opens and displays the specified palette contents. |
| The PaletteController from TopComponent's Lookup takes precedens over the PaletteController |
| found from mime type lookup in the XML layer (if any) for backwards compatibility. |
| </p> |
| <p>The new API is fully backwards compatible and there are no implications for existing |
| palette providers.</p> |
| </description> |
| <issue number="90213"/> |
| </change> |

| <change id="disable-palette-window" > |
| <api name="palette_api"/> |
| <summary>Allow to turn the auto-show of palette window on/off.</summary> |
| <version major="1" minor="29"/> |
| <date day="8" month="11" year="2011"/> |
| <author login="saubrecht"/> |
| <compatibility addition="yes" binary="compatible" deletion="no" semantic="compatible" deprecation="no" modification="no" source="compatible"/> |
| <description> |
| <p> |
| A new branding token <code>Palette.Window.Enabled</code> in |
| <code>org.netbeans.spi.palette</code> package allows to turn the automatic display of palette |
| window on/off. When the property value is <code>false</code> then |
| the palette window will not show when an editor with palette |
| content is activated. The user must open/close the palette window |
| manually. The default value is <code>true</code> which means |
| the palette window will auto-show/hide when active editor changes. |
| Note: The palette window is part of <code>commonpalette</code> TopComponent group |
| which the form designer opens when activated. So to turn the palette |
| window off completely it is necessary to remove its reference |
| from that group. |
| </p> |
| </description> |
| <issue number="204786"/> |
| </change> |
